Using Na (seizing) to confuse

Na or seizing can be applied in pushhands practice by sticking to and manipulating the space between the joints. This method will confuse your opponent by pulling his body internally via the connection to the connective tissue in the joint. When it is being applied to you will find yourself being confused and not understanding how your body is reacting.
